Installation Process

The installation process for a cat window flap typically includes the following actions:
Measuring the Window or Door: The installer determines the window or door to identify the best location for the cat window flap.Cutting a Hole: A hole is cut into the window or door to accommodate the cat window flap.Setting up the Flap: The cat window flap is installed into the hole, typically utilizing screws or adhesive.Sealing the Edges: The edges of the flap are sealed to avoid air leaks and moisture from going into your house.Testing the Flap: The installer evaluates the flap to make sure that it is working properly which the cat can pass through easily.

Q: What is the best material for a cat window flap?A: The best product for a cat window flap depends upon the environment and the wanted level of resilience. Typical materials consist of plastic, metal, and wood.

Q: Can I install a cat window flap myself?A: Yes, it is possible to set up a cat window flap yourself using a DIY kit. However, if you are not comfortable with DIY projects or if you have a complicated installation, it is advised to hire a professional installer.

Q: How long does it require to install a cat window flap?A: The installation time for a cat window flap normally varies from 30 minutes to several hours, depending upon the complexity of the installation and the type of flap being set up.

Q: Can I install a cat window flap in a rental residential or commercial property?A: It is recommended to consult your landlord or residential or commercial property manager before installing a cat window flap in a rental property. Some rental contracts may forbid the installation of cat window flaps or require consent from the property owner.
